Re: LHD to RHD? WHO KNOWS WHO CAN DO IT? (rhd type r)
Tegboi on G2ic did the conversion with his LHD firewall and cut new holes and put in the parts like that and it works fine
the only thing he didnt do was use the RHD harness so he had to extend alot of wires, i would recomend getting the RHD wire harness if you decide to use your LHD firewall, you end up keeping your original vin too so you dont have to worry about getting hassled if you get your hood popped and vin checked
